Learning pixel art via the tutorials. Used a reference photo. Blocked out the shape. Made my own color ramps starting with mid grade colors selected from reference photo for the black and the brown. A third I made up for leg brown when I noticed it was redder than the rest if the brown on the body and tried to intersect this ramp with the black but had no idea what I was doing (I matched the saturation and lightness of one of the darker blacks but changed the hue to make it 'redder')... Decided on lighting direction. Didn't know what I was doing but used reference photo to attempt to understand how the light would fall on different parts of the body. Placed the background legs relative to the photo weight-wise but brought them down to an even 2D plane with the foreground ones. Uhh... that's about it.
